BOMAG ANNOUNCE ACROSS THE BOARD PRICE INCREASE IN THE UK
Press release May 5, 2009 Construction15% INCREASE FROM JUNE 1ST 2009
BOMAG, the market leader in compaction, has just announced an across the board price increase of 15% in the UK, effective June 1st 2009. The 15% increase applies to the full range of BOMAG light and heavy compaction products including Landfill Compactors and BOMAG Milling and Paving equipment for the road construction market. The increase is a direct result of the shift in the value of the pound against the Euro. In the last 2 years the pound has averaged €1.12 with a high of €1.50 and a low of €1.01. The current rate being €1.12 to the pound at the Interbank rate.
Most pundits expect the exchange rate to settle at the €1.25 to the pound level? The UK market for construction equipment was the largest in Western Europe in 2007 but demand has fallen away. The current market, for a broad range of construction equipment, is down by 70% year on year.
